我通過redis命令列表進行搜索。我無法找到命令獲取redis pub/sub中的所有可用頻道。在流星服務器中,等效命令是LISTCHANNELS
,其中列出了所有已知通道,每個通道上存儲的消息數和當前用戶數。Redis命令獲取pub/sub的所有可用頻道?
我有一個需要定期瞭解可用頻道的cron。 redis是否有本地命令?或者我需要找到一種方法來實現它自己?
我通過redis命令列表進行搜索。我無法找到命令獲取redis pub/sub中的所有可用頻道。在流星服務器中,等效命令是LISTCHANNELS
,其中列出了所有已知通道,每個通道上存儲的消息數和當前用戶數。Redis命令獲取pub/sub的所有可用頻道?
我有一個需要定期瞭解可用頻道的cron。 redis是否有本地命令?或者我需要找到一種方法來實現它自己?
PUBSUB CHANNELS
從版本2.8.0開始。
沒有現有命令 - 請參閱http://redis.io/commands#pubsub。 您可以將所有頻道的名稱保存在SET
中,並在需要時檢索它們。
列出所有Redis的通道(2路):
PUBSUB CHANNELS
PUBSUB CHANNELS *
或者使用通配符名稱:
PUBSUB CHANNELS mystarter*
他們將檢查哪些配襯琴絃更多的參考轉到模式: http://redis.io/commands/pubsub
您可以通過info命令瞭解no通道 –